How much do temporary coordinator j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 18, 2026, the average hourly pay for temporary coordinator in Raleigh, NC is $20.01,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.50 and $20.91 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a temporary coordinator?

Temporary Coordinators are professionals hired on a short-term basis to manage projects, events, or administrative tasks within an organization. They often step in to fill staffing gaps, support special projects, or assist during peak periods. Their responsibilities typically include coordinating schedules, communicating with team members, organizing resources, and ensuring tasks are completed efficiently. Temporary Coordinators need strong organizational and interpersonal skills to adapt quickly to new environments and deliver results within a limited timeframe.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a temporary coordinator,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Temporary Coordinator, you typically need strong organizational abilities, attention to detail, and experience in administrative or project coordination roles. Familiarity with office software (such as Microsoft Office Suite), scheduling systems, and sometimes project management tools is often required. Excellent communication, adaptability, and problem-solving skills help individuals stand out in this position. These skills and qualities ensure smooth operations, efficient task management, and successful collaboration during short-term assignments.

What are some common challenges faced by temporary coordinators, and how can they be addressed?

Temporary Coordinators often step into fast-paced environments where immediate adaptability is crucial. One common challenge is quickly learning new systems and processes while managing multiple tasks across departments. Building strong communication skills and proactively seeking clarification can help ease the transition. Additionally, Temporary Coordinators may need to establish rapport with permanent team members swiftly; being approachable and open to feedback can foster collaboration and ensure project success.

General Summary
Upholds the Core Values as determined by the management team. Primary responsibility for all positions with Westlake Hardware is to Amaze Every Customer Every Time. The Inventory Coordinator's role also requires they foster a commitment to generate an in-stock position to satisfy every customer by having the right product, in the right quantity, at the right time.
The Inventory Coordinator position is responsible for the overall inventory integrity and maintenance of a store's inventory following Ace's inventory best practices and metrics - some of which are outlined as follows:
  • Inventory Record Accuracy-IRA (Change in Quantity on Hand, Credit PO's, Direct Ship, etc.)
  • In Stock Position (Maximum Stock Level, Minimum Order Point, Store Use, etc.)
  • Assortment (Product Mix)
  • Unproductive Inventory (Overstock, Obsolete, Discontinued, Markdowns, etc.)
  • Shrink (Loss, Damage, etc.)

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
  • Familiarize and stay abreast of inventory Best Practices within the Ace Way of Retailing
  • Ensure data accuracy within the system to maintain adequate inventory levels
  • Train store staff on best practices and create a culture that is focused on Inventory Health
  • Collaborate with all associates to help identify errors and correct them as necessary by addressing the root causes
  • Conduct, research, and address/reinforce Ace Way of Retailing best practices for the following processes (inclusive but not limited to):
    • Negative Reports and make corrections as necessary
    • "Shoot the Outs," research variances, and make corrections as needed
    • Permanent and temporary outs via Item Change Management
    • Mango Count Sheets and exception reports.
    • Unproductive inventory management including Obsolete and Overstock Inventory
    • Monitor shrinkage, recommend ways to reduce theft and breakage, and make corrections in inventory system
    • Maintain accuracy of all location codes
    • Print bin tags (labels) as required
